Thanks for the responses. My wife has been driving the X5 for over three years now with similar driving habits all three years. The problem just showed up for the first time about 3 months ago and started increasing in frequency. As my wife no longer trust the truck, I have been driving it for the past few days without incident. The road trip is this weekend which will be the acid test.

I understand short trips might not fully charge the battery, but that does not explain the battery going dead while driving. If the battery had enough charge to start the vehicle, the alternator should be sufficient to keep it running and provide excess current to the battery to at least maintain its currently level of charge. It was not happening, hence my decision to replace the alternator.
